Meanwhile he also hoped that money would be given him by Paul, that he might release him. Therefore he sent for him more often and conversed with him. Acts 24:26

The good examples of the people who served the Lord must be followed and imitated by all who were called to be a part of the Body of Christ.  Besides this great privilege we cannot give the devil the satisfaction of removing us from the presence of God and preventing us from duly preparing ourselves to enter the Kingdom of God. We know that the lost will be separated from eternal joy.

It is true that to be tempted does not mean we have sinned. However, those that like temptation and let it fall into their hearts will begin to suffer more in the hands of the enemy. So, if there is no repentance, they will not ascend with Jesus on the Day of His return to retrieve those that remained faithful. Why dismiss and waste the great opportunity to be accepted by the All-Powerful and to be with Him forever?  Definitely nothing is worth losing to eternal damnation.

Because of the Jews who did not accept Christ as Savior and stuck to blind faith in the Law of Moses which they did not keep, Paul appealed to Caesar and was taken to Rome to be judged by this worldly emperor who was in the flesh and demon possessed. Would it not have been better if they had been converted and learned what Moses had learned with the Lord?  They were lost because they did not love the Almighty.

Had he been weak in faith, Paul would have given money to Felix, the governor. In spite of being in the presence of the man powerfully used by God, that corrupt politician had eyes only for money and dismissed the opportunity to be saved and called to enter the Kingdom of Heaven. The adulterer who sees a person with lust and sinful eyes does not see in that person the Christ that they love, but only someone that they want to lead to perdition.

The future of those that have been corrupted is the same as of the homicide, adulterers and other criminals that forewent the chance to repent and enter into Heaven through the Narrow and Straight Door (Luke 13.24). Flee from those that do not love the Lord even though they may seem to be of God. If either of you is already married, the temptation that arises between you is purely Satanic and must be rejected and refused outright.

If those that are called to salvation – to be citizens of Heaven consequently – do not confess and get rid of their sins, they will have the same fate of those that refused offhand the offer of the Lord.  No matter how long you have been in the Way or what you may have done for the Kingdom of God; sinning will disconnect you from the Kingdom and lead you to the abyss.

What do you prefer?  A little money now, to fulfill the devil’s wishes or suffer if necessary like Paul suffered and gain eternal life?  Does the pleasure of a forbidden practice make eternal suffering worthwhile?  Of course it does not. So take care not to fall. Keep watch and pray because if you fall into temptation you may be lost forever. Mercy!
